4,6-alpha-glucanotransferase GtfB from Limosilactobacillus reuteri NCC 2613 complexed with acarbose Descriptor: 4,6-dideoxy-4-{[(1S,4R,5S,6S)-4,5,6-trihydroxy-3-(hydroxymethyl)cyclohex-2-en-1-yl]amino}-alpha-D-glucopyranose-(1-4)-alpha-D-glucopyranose-(1-4)-beta-D-glucopyranose, CALCIUM ION, Dextransucrase, ... Authors: Pijning, T, te Poele, E, Gangoiti, J, Boerner, T, Dijkhuizen, L. Deposit date: 2021-07-07 Release date: 2021-11-03 Last modified: 2024-05-01 Method: X-RAY DIFFRACTION (2.9 Å) Cite: Insights into Broad-Specificity Starch Modification from the Crystal Structure of Limosilactobacillus Reuteri NCC 2613 4,6-alpha-Glucanotransferase GtfB. J.Agric.Food Chem., 69, 2021
